Private Pilot Certificate

-Be English Proficient 

-Be at least 16 years of age to solo, 17 years of age for your pilot’s license 

-Proof of citizenship of TSA approval prior to training

-Obtain a Third Class Medical Certificate prior to first solo

-A minimum of 40 hours of training: 20 hours dual instruction, 20 hours solo

-Pass the written exam with a minimum of 70%

Typical completion time 50-60hours

Instrument Rating

-Hold a Private Pilot Certificate 

-Obtain a Third Class Medical Certificate 

-Proof of citizenship or TSA approval prior to training 

-50 hours of PIC cross-country

-40 hours of actual or simulated instrument time

-250NM cross-country under simulated instrument conditions

-Pass a written exam with a 70%

-Typical completion time 50-60 hours

Commercial Pilot Certificate

-Hold a Private Pilot Certificate 

-Obtain a Second Class Medical Certificate 

-Proof of citizenship or TSA approval prior to training

-Must have at least 250 hours total time 

-100 hours of PIC

-10 hours instrument, 10 hours complex aircraft 

-300 NM cross-country 

-Pass a written exam with a minimum of 70%

-Typical completion time 30 hours

Flight Instructor (CFI, CFII, MEI)

-Hold a Commercial Pilot Certificate 

-Hold an Instrument Rating 

-Obtain a minimum Third Class Medical Certificate 

-Pass at least two written exams with a minimum of 70% (FOI and FIA)

-Typical completion time: 40 hours ground, 20 hours flight time

Airline Transport Pilot

-Proof of citizenship of TSA approval prior to training 

-Obtain a First Class Medical Certificate 

-A minimum of 1500 hours of total time 

-Typical completion time: 20 hours ground, 20 hours flight time

Sport Pilot License

-Be English proficient 

-Be at least 16 years of age to solo, 17 years of age for your pilot’s license 

-Proof of citizenship of TSA approval prior to training

-A minimum of 20 hours of training: 15 hours dual instruction, 5 hours solo
